WebDec 5, 2024 · Fever and Rash Causes and Risk Factors. Fever with rash can have infectious or noninfectious causes and can occur in both children and adults. 1 The severity can range from minor to life-threatening. Patients who have weakened immune systems are at heightened risk for more severe illness. WebMay 27, 2024 · The cardinal features of serum sickness are rash, fever, and polyarthralgias or polyarthritis, which begin one to two weeks after the first exposure to the responsible agent and resolve within a few weeks of discontinuation. Although patients may appear very ill and uncomfortable during the acute febrile stage, the disease is self-limited, and ...
